Southeast Asia
Manila claims 20 ‘Muslim rebels' killed in fresh fighting
2002-10-13
The Philippine armed forces claimed today that its troops have killed 20 "Muslim rebels", as fighting raged for the second day on Sunday in the southern Muslim heartland. The latest operation was launched after another guerrilla group killed 11 soldiers and wounded 26 others in a separate clash on Jolo island, off Mindanao. The military said it carried out air-and-ground offensive on Saturday on a rebel camp in Lanao del Sur province on the main southern island of Mindanao. It however did not specify who the rebels were, whether they are the communist guerillas, the kidnap-for-ransom Abu Sayyaf group, the Moro National Liberation Front or the Moro Islamic Liberation Front, both of whose members have been fighting for independence for the southern Muslim-majority heartlands.

"As of this morning, about 20 rebels were killed and several others wounded in the first wave of ground assault (in Lanao del Sur),", armed forces chief General Benjamin Defensor said, adding that he would "destroy any armed group who will undermine government efforts to bring peace and development in Mindanao".
